Abstract

本发明揭示了一种设备分组管理系统、方法及装置,属于智能家居领域。所述方法包括:在接收到将目标设备添加至目标分组的添加指令后,向所述目标设备发送广播指令,所述广播指令用于触发所述目标设备广播信号;接收参考设备发送的信号强度,所述信号强度是所述参考设备在接收到所述目标设备广播的所述信号时,获取的所述信号的信号强度;根据各个参考设备反馈的信号强度,对各个参考设备进行排序;解决了相关技术中逐个查找智能设备进行分组的方式,效率低和出错率高的问题;达到了方便用户快速选取出与该目标设备可能位于同一组的设备,提高分组的效率和分组准确度的效果。

技术领域
本发明涉及智能家居领域,特别涉及一种设备分组管理系统、方法及装置。
背景技术
随着家庭中智能家居设备数量的增多,移动终端需要控制的智能家居设备数量也越来越多。
为了便于管理,用户通常会想将同一个房间的多个智能设备划分为一组中,在实际分组过程中,用户需要依次查找同一个房间内的智能设备,并将查找到的智能设备添加至该房间所对应的分组中。这种从大量的智能设备中逐个查找智能设备的方式,效率比较低,出错率较高。
发明内容
为解决相关技术中逐个查找智能设备进行分组的方式,效率低和出错率高的问题,本发明提供了一种设备分组管理系统、方法及装置。

具体实施方式
这里将详细地对示例性实施例进行说明,其示例表示在附图中。下面的描述涉及附图时,除非另有表示,不同附图中的相同数字表示相同或相似的要素。以下示例性实施例中所描述的实施方式并不代表与本发明相一致的所有实施方式。相反,它们仅是与如所附权利要求书中所详述的、本发明的一些方面相一致的装置和方法的例子。
图1是根据部分示例性实施例示出的一种设备分组管理方法所涉及的实施环境的示意图,如图1所示,该实施环境中可以包括管理端120、目标设备140和参考设备160。
管理端120可以是手机、平板电脑、服务器等。
目标设备140和参考设备160可以是具有无线信号收发功能的设备,比如可以是智能灯泡、智能插座、智能电视、空调、冰箱等。本发明中将被选定的将要添加至分组中的智能设备作为目标设备140,将其余的智能设备作为参考设备160。
在实际家居场景中,目标设备140可以和部分参考设备160位于同一个房间,与另外部分参考设备160位于不同的房间,本实施例对此不做限定。
管理端120和目标设备140之间可以通过有线网络方式或无线网络方式建立连接。
可选的,该实施环境还可以包括路由器180,路由器180为管理端120、目标设备140以及参考设备160提供Wi-Fi(Wireless-Fidelity,无线保真)连接。
以下各个实施例均以应用于图1所示的实施环境进行举例说明。
图2A是根据一示例性实施例示出的一种设备分组管理系统的框图,如图2A所示,该设备分组管理系统包括管理端210、目标设备220和参考设备230。
管理端210,被配置为在接收到将目标设备220添加至目标分组的添加指令后,向目标设备220发送广播指令。
目标设备220是用户在管理端210中选择的将要进行分组的智能设备。
这里所讲的目标分组可以是用户建立的用于存储多个智能设备的分组。为了便于统一管理,目标分组可以用于存放可能位于同一房间的智能设备或需要同时控制的智能设备。
在实际实现时,目标分组可以是管理端210预先设置的;也可以是用户手动添加的,在目标分组为用户手动添加时,用户还可以为添加的目标分组进行命名。
例如,以目标分组为“客厅”为例,可以将客厅中的所有的智能灯泡、智能电视等智能设备存放在“客厅”分组中,这样,用户可以同时控制客厅中的智能设备。
添加指令可以是用户向目标分组中添加选择的智能设备时产生的指令。举例来讲,当用户选中管理端210中的一个智能设备,并触发了某个目标分组中提供的添加控件后,管理端210则生成将该智能设备添加至该目标分组的添加指令。
管理端210接收将目标设备220添加至目标分组的添加指令,并在接收到该添加指令后向该目标设备220发送广播指令,该广播指令用于指示目标设备220广播信号。
在一种可能的实施方式中,管理端210向目标设备220发送广播指令时,可以进一步指示目标设备220广播信号的次数和广播信号时的间隔时长。比如,管理端210将限定的次数和间隔时长作为参数添加至广播指令所对应的数据包中。对应的,目标设备220在接收到该数据包时,可以解析出所携带的次数和间隔时长,由此可以根据管理端210所指示的间隔时长广播信号,直至广播所指示的次数为止。这样,可以确保各个参考设备230都能接收到目标设备220广播的信号。
可选的,广播指令也可以不指示目标设备220广播的广播次数和间隔时长,目标设备220可以根据预先设置的广播次数和间隔时长广播信号。
可选的,管理端210向目标设备220发送广播指令,该广播指令可以包含指示目标设备220广播信号时的功率,对应的,该目标设备220可以根据该广播指令中携带的功率广播信号。
可选的,广播指令中也可以不携带功率,目标设备220可以根据预先设置的功率广播信号。
目标设备220,被配置为在接收到管理端210发送的广播指令后,广播信号。
目标设备220在接收到管理端210发送的广播指令后,广播信号,目标设备220在广播信号时可以根据预先设定的功率广播信号,也可以是根据广播指令中携带的由管理端210指示的功率广播信号。
在实际实现时,由于参考设备230通常位于目标设备220的附近,因此在目标设备220广播信号时,参考设备230可以接收到目标设备220广播的信号。进一步的,参考设备230,被配置为在接收到信号时,获取信号的信号强度,并将信号强度反馈至管理端210。
在一种可能的实施方式中,参考设备230向管理端210除了反馈接收到的信号的信号强度之外,还可以反馈接收到该信号的参考设备230的标识。
可选的,参考设备230在向管理端210反馈信号强度时,可以将信号强度封装在数据包的包体内。可选的,参考设备230还可以将自身的标识封装在该数据包的包体或包头内,以便于管理端210可以在对该数据包进行解封装后,获取该参考设备230接收到的信号的信号强度以及该参考设备230的标识。
管理端210,还被配置为根据各个参考设备230反馈的信号强度,对各个参考设备230进行排序。
在一种可能的实施方式中,管理端210可以根据各个参考设备230反馈的信号强度,按照信号强度由强到弱依次对各个参考设备230进行排序。一般来讲,参考设备230在反馈信号强度时,会对应反馈参考设备230的标识。因此,管理端210可以根据信号强度来排序这些信号强度所对应的标识,也即对发送信号强度的参考设备230进行排序。
为了能够实现对智能设备进行分组,管理端210首先需要自动获取各个智能设备,然后将这些智能设备提供给用户,以便用户从中选择一个智能设备作为目标设备。可选的,管理端210获取的各个智能设备是登录在管理端210的用户账号所绑定的各个智能设备,或者,为与管理端210位于相同局域网内的各个智能设备。
在实际实现时,管理端210,还被配置为接收设置目标分组的设置指令,根据设置指令生成目标分组,生成的目标分组中设置有用于添加目标设备220的控件;在控件被触发后,管理端210显示获取到的各个智能设备,将用户选定的智能设备确定为目标设备220。
举例来讲,请参照图2B,图2B中示出了管理端210的3种不同时刻的界面20、21和22。在界面20中,示出了一个客厅分组23,在客厅分组23下方有一个用于添加目标设备220的控件24,当用户点击控件24,管理端210为用户展示界面21,在界面21中显示有多个智能设备,该多个智能设备可以是与该管理端210所登录的用户账号绑定的各个智能设备,也可以是与该管理端210位于同一局域网内的各个智能设备。当界面21中的智能灯泡26所对应的控件被触发时,管理端210将智能灯泡26确定为目标设备220,即接收到了将该目标设备220添加至客厅分组23中的添加指令,此时除智能灯泡26外的其他智能设 备均为参考设备230。这样,管理端210即向智能灯泡26(也即目标设备220)发送广播指令,智能灯泡26根据该广播指令广播信号,参考设备230将接收到的信号的信号强度反馈给管理端210。管理端210根据参考设备230反馈的信号强度,为用户展示图2B中的界面22,界面22中含有一个列表框28,列表框28用于向用户展示排序后的各个参考设备230。
需要说明的是,图2B中的控件以及文字均仅是一种示例性举例,并不用于限定本发明的实际产品的展示,其中未完全示出的部分是被对应的悬浮框遮盖的部分,原则上,在悬浮框显示时,这些未完全示出的部分无法被用户直接操作或查看。
在一种可能的实现方式中,同一分组中智能设备的类型可以为同一类型,此时在添加一个目标设备时,可以显示与该目标设备同类型的智能设备,以供用户后续选择可以添加至同一分组的智能设备。此时,管理端210,还被配置为获取目标设备220的类型,筛选出类型与目标设备220相同的参考设备230,或者,筛选出信号强度大于预定强度阈值的参考设备230,根据各个参考设备230反馈的信号强度,对筛选出的参考设备230进行排序。
举例来讲,若管理端210获取到目标设备220的类型为智能灯泡时,则在用于显示排序后的智能设备的列表框中,可以仅显示排序后的智能灯泡。或者,管理端210接收到各个参考设备230反馈的信号强度后,筛选出信号强度大于预定强度阈值的参考设备230,在用于显示排序后的智能设备的列表框中,可以仅展示信号强度大于预定强度阈值的参考设备230。这样,能够达到更便于用户对同一个房间内的同类型的智能设备的管控和维护,减少排序的时间,提高排序的效率的效果。
可选的,管理端210,还被配置为确定出从排序后的参考设备230中选择的一个参考设备230,将参考设备230添加至目标分组中。
仍旧以图2B为例,若用户点击了列表框28中的电视,并点击确认控件29,那么电视即被添加至客厅分组23中。
在实际应用中,目标设备220所广播的信号可能由于其他因素导致丢失或者受到干扰,为了避免这种情况对参考设备230接收到的信号的影响,目标设备220可以多次广播信号。而为了保证参考设备230多次接收到的信号能够较准确的反映其与目标设备220之间的距离,目标设备220,还被配置为按照相同的发射功率广播信号。
